  • The School of Theatre at Florida State University presents
    You on the Moors Now
    by Jaclyn Backhaus

    LAB THEATRE

    Four iconic heroines. One epic showdown. Elizabeth Bennet, Catherine Earnshaw, Jane Eyre, and Jo March are so over playing by the rules. When their legendary suitors show up with rings, these literary rebels ignite a fire of passion and defiance, rewriting their stories with a 21st-century twist. Get ready for a literary smackdown where romance meets revolution, and happily-ever-after is just the beginning. This audacious mashup of Pride and Prejudice, Wuthering Heights, Jane Eyre, and Little Women will leave you cheering for these heroines who are finally writing their own endings!

    Originally developed with John Kurzynowski and Theater Reconstruction Ensemble.
  • The School of Theatre at Florida State University presents
    Sweeney Todd The Demon Barber of Fleet Street
    Music & Lyrics by Stephen Sondheim | Book by Hugh Wheeler | From an Adaptation by Christopher Bond | Originally Directed on Broadway by Harold Prince | Orchestrations by Jonathan Tunick

    FALLON THEATRE

    Attend the tale of Sweeney Todd! In the foggy streets of nineteenth century London something dark is being concocted. Sweeney Todd, back from a 15-year exile and hungry for revenge, opens his razor-sharp barber shop above Mrs. Lovett's floundering pie shop. But when Todd's thirst for vengeance takes a deliciously dark turn, Mrs. Lovett finds a new "secret ingredient" that'll have Fleet Street dying for more. This devilish duo is about to give London a taste of something truly hair-raising!

    Originally produced on Broadway by Richard Barr, Charles Woodward, Robert Fryer, Mary Lea Johnson, Martin Richards in Association with Dean and Judy Manos.   • River Selby will be discussing their debut memoir, Hotshot: A Life on Fire with Professor Ravi Howard.

    From 2000 to 2010, River Selby was a wildland firefighter whose given name was Anastasia. This is a memoir of that time in their life--of Ana, the struggles she encountered, and the constraints of what it means to be female-bodied in a male-dominated industry. An illuminating debut from a fierce new voice, HOTSHOT is a timely reckoning with both the personal and environmental dangers of wildland firefighting. Hotshot is an Amazon Editor's Pick, Goodreads September memoir pick, and has been reviewed by NPR and the San Francisco Chronicle.
  • The School of Theatre at Florida State University presents
    Junie B. Jones The Musical
    Book & Lyrics by Marcy Heisler | Music by Zina Goldrich | Adapted from the JUNIE B. JONES Series of books by Barbara Park

    FALLON THEATRE

    Growing up is a vibrant adventure, and no one embraces it quite like Junie B. Jones! Junie takes the stage by storm, turning first grade into a hilarious, heart-filled adventure. From cafeteria chaos to classroom capers, this irrepressible kid navigates the ups and downs of growing up with her signature spunk. Based on the beloved book series, this colorful musical is a joyful celebration of childhood that will leave you smiling from ear to ear. It's gonna be so much fun!

  • Celebrating the creativity and resilience of refugee women from Afghaistan, Congo, Syria and Sudan, Journey of Memories showcases artwork that reflects cherished memories of home, the strength found in their journeys, and the hope guiding their futures.
    Through vibrant handcrafted pieces, the exhibition highlights the power of art to connect cultures, share stories, and inspire new beginnings. Journey of Memories invites audiences to experience not only the challenges of migration, but also the beauty courage and imagination these women carry with them.
